Sherman -- who never allows thinking to interfere with life's simple pleasures, especially eating -- is joined by Fillmore, his trusty turtle sidekick; Megan, his significant shark other; Hawthorne, the irascible hermit crab; and a host of other Neptunian neighbors occupying the lagoon of an imaginary South Pacific island called Kapupu.
This cast of coral reef critters never fails to amuse: Consider Sherman opening a wrapped holiday gift box only to find a putrid dead fish -- and loving it! Or the day he and Fillmore contemplate plunging to the deepest depths of the ocean, in order to recover Fillmore's fumbled Ninja Turtle Decoder Ring.
Syndicated for six years, Sherman's Lagoon harpoons its twentysomething target audience with ease, while its cuddly characters and edgy humor capture children and adult readers respectively. Even those who visit Sherman on his own Web site (www.slagoon.com) will want this wacky assortment of comedic columns. Sherman's Lagoon is a crowd-pleaser that has made a considerablesplash!
